FCC imposes first cybersecurity fine

From: Inside Counsel

Charges telecom provider $10 million for negligent private information policies

By Chris DiMarco

Private customer information has become a business asset in the connected age, and as criminals increasingly target large corporations to extract that information, regulators are being brought to task over how to implement fines for those who leave their data vulnerable.
